Abstract

The invention discloses a glass column circular head grinding and counting device. The device comprises a frame; the frame is correspondingly provided with a fixing module and a grinding module; a driving module for driving the fixing module to perform a reciprocating motion is arranged in the frame; the grinding module includes a groove formed in the frame; a through groove is formed in the center of the groove, and is provided with a bearing; the bearing is coaxially provided with a vertical rotating shaft; the rotating shaft is coaxially provided with a rotating disc; the rotating disc is arranged at the upper part of the bearing; a fixed disc is arranged at the upper part of the rotating disc; a grinding wheel is horizontally arranged at the top end of the rotating shaft; a first motor is coaxially arranged at the lower part of the rotating shaft; a plastic protecting layer is arranged in the groove; a counter is coaxially arranged on the rotating shaft, and is positioned between the first motor and the bearing; a control switch is arranged on the frame for controlling starting and ending of equipment; and a controller is arranged in the frame, and is used for connecting the counter with the control switch.
